Is online casino play legal in Manitoba?

The only online casino sanctioned in Manitoba is PlayNow, operated by Manitoba Liquor and Lotteries. No private company holds a provincial registration to offer online casino games here, because the province has not created a framework for one.

Offshore operators will accept players from here, and playing at one is not prosecuted at the player level. The cost is not legal risk to you — it is that nobody in this province is obliged to help you when something goes wrong.

That is a real difference from Ontario and Alberta, where a registered operator answers to a regulator that can compel a remedy.

Who regulates online gambling in Manitoba

Manitoba Liquor and Lotteries. Its remit covers the provincial offering rather than the wider market: it can hold PlayNow to account, and it has no authority over an offshore site that accepts you.

That distinction is the reason the regulatory-standing criterion — a quarter of our total — cannot be earned here by a commercial operator.

Where a complaint actually goes

In Manitoba, the operator, then whichever authority licensed it offshore. There is no provincial body in the chain, so the last word belongs to whichever authority licensed the operator abroad.

Some offshore licences do carry a real dispute process. The Kahnawà:ke Gaming Commission — itself Canadian, based in Mohawk territory in Quebec — staffs a full-time Dispute Resolution Officer and will investigate complaints once you have exhausted the operator's own process. Malta operates an adjudication route. Curaçao's framework is lighter, and formal escalation rights for players remain limited. Self-exclusion, and its limits here

Manitoba has no province-wide self-exclusion register binding commercial operators. Any exclusion you set applies to the single site you set it on.

That matters more than it sounds. An exclusion that stops at one operator does nothing about the next, and the next is a search away. It is the reason the safer-gambling criterion cannot reach full marks in this province no matter how good an individual operator's tools are.

Free, confidential help is available regardless of where you play. ConnexOntario answers from anywhere in Canada, and the Responsible Gambling Council publishes resources for every province.

What you can still judge about an operator from Manitoba

Thirty-five of our hundred points do not depend on your province, and they are worth using: whether player balances are ring-fenced from operating capital, whether an accredited laboratory has tested the games and published a certificate you can open, and whether ownership and withdrawal terms are stated plainly rather than buried.

Those three are the honest basis for a comparison from here. Our national comparison ranks on exactly those and says plainly which points it cannot award.

The legal gambling age in Manitoba is 18

Eighteen. Manitoba is one of only three provinces at eighteen — the others are Alberta and Quebec. A national guide that states nineteen throughout is not written for here.

How the regulated provinces compare

A player in Ontario or Alberta has a regulator, an escalation route beyond the operator, and a binding province-wide exclusion register. A player in Manitoba has none of the three. Is online gambling legal in Manitoba?

PlayNow is the only sanctioned online casino here. Offshore sites will accept you and playing at one is not prosecuted at the player level, but no provincial body is obliged to hear a complaint about them.

Which online casino is safest in Manitoba?

We will not name one as safest, and here the honest answer is narrower than usual: more than half our rubric measures protections that do not exist in this province. What we can compare is fund protection, independent game testing and transparency of terms.

What is the legal gambling age in Manitoba?

18. Alberta, Manitoba and Quebec are the three provinces at eighteen.

Where do I complain if an operator will not pay?

The operator, then whichever authority licensed it offshore. Exhaust the operator's own process first and keep every message; the licensor will ask for it. Kahnawà:ke and Malta both run real dispute processes, Curaçao's is lighter.

Can I self-exclude across all sites in Manitoba?

No. There is no province-wide register binding commercial operators here, so an exclusion applies only to the site you set it on. Ontario and Alberta both have binding province-wide systems.

Are winnings taxable?

Not for recreational players anywhere in Canada. Gambling winnings are generally not treated as income.

Will this province regulate online casinos?

Ontario opened a market in 2022 and Alberta followed. Others have signalled interest at various times, but nothing is settled. We describe the position as it stands rather than speculating, and this page changes when the position does.
